AdBlue, a high-purity solution composed of 32.5% urea and 67.5% deionized water, is commonly utilized in diesel vehicles to reduce dangerous nitrogen oxide (NOx) emissions. It’s an essential part of many modern diesel engines that comply with stringent emissions standards, such because the Euro 6 regulation. Nonetheless, some vehicle owners and fanatics have raised the question: might disabling AdBlue improve a vehicle’s efficiency? This article explores the possible benefits, the potential risks, and the ethical considerations involved in disabling AdBlue systems.
What Is AdBlue and How Does It Work?
AdBlue is utilized in Selective Catalytic Reduction (SCR) systems, which are designed to reduce NOx emissions in diesel vehicles. When the AdBlue resolution is injected into the exhaust gases, it reacts with the NOx to transform it into hurtless nitrogen and water vapor. This process is crucial for guaranteeing that vehicles meet environmental standards, however it also has certain effects on vehicle performance and efficiency.

Risks and Drawbacks
While disabling AdBlue could seem appealing, it is necessary to understand the potential risks concerned:
1. Increased Emissions
Probably the most significant downside of disabling AdBlue is the rise in harmful emissions. AdBlue’s primary function is to reduce NOx emissions, which are dangerous pollutants that contribute to air air pollution, smog, and acid rain. By disabling the system, the vehicle will release higher levels of NOx into the environment, potentially violating environmental rules and contributing to the degradation of air quality.
2. Legal and Regulatory Points
In many nations, disabling AdBlue systems is illegal. Modern diesel vehicles are required to conform with emissions standards, and tampering with emissions-control systems can lead to hefty fines and penalties. In the European Union, for instance, it is a criminal offense to disable or modify any emissions control systems in vehicles. Equally, within the United States, tampering with an emissions control system violates the Clean Air Act. Due to this fact, vehicle owners ought to careabsolutely consider the legal implications earlier than making any modifications.
3. Potential Damage to the Engine
Modern diesel engines are engineered to work in tandem with the AdBlue system. Disabling the SCR system could interfere with the engine’s optimum operation. In some cases, this might lead to long-term engine damage, reduced lifespan, and potential warranty issues. Manufacturers typically do not cover damages ensuing from modifications to emissions control systems, which means the vehicle owner would bear the full cost of repairs.
